Why Does My Cat Sleep On Her Cardboard Scratcher. The cardboard has a unique build that gives satisfying scratching sounds that soothes your cat’s nerves. Place scratching posts in areas where your cat likes to scratch. These pads help fulfill a cat's instinctual need to scratch while also offering an alternative to furniture and carpets, ultimately promoting healthy claw maintenance and reducing unwanted scratching behavior.
